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for 2022 was approximately ¥1.32 billion, representing a 5.37% increase compared to ¥1.26 billion in 2021[62]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ders for 2022 was approximately ¥411.19 million, an increase of 7.92% from ¥381.02 million in 2021[62]. -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was approximately ¥391.08 million, up 8.94% from ¥358.97 million in the previous year[62]. - Cash flow from operating activities increased significantly by 114.70%, reaching approximately ¥509.66 million compared to ¥237.38 million in 2021[62]. - The total assets at the end of 2022 were approximately ¥4.71 billion, a 25.36% increase from ¥3.75 billion at the end of 2021[62]. - The net assets attributable to shareholders at the end of 2022 were approximately ¥2.68 billion, reflecting a 16.12% increase from ¥2.31 billion in 2021[62]. - The basic earnings per share for 2022 was ¥2.42, an increase of 7.56% from ¥2.25 in 2021[62]. - The diluted earnings per share for 2022 was also ¥2.42, up 8.04% from ¥2.24 in the previous year[62]. - The weighted average return on equity for 2022 was 16.63%, down from 19.02% in 2021[62]. Profit Distribution Policy - The profit distribution policy emphasizes a cash dividend approach, with a minimum of 80% of profits allocated to cash dividends during mature development stages without significant capital expenditures[35]. - The board of directors and supervisory board will consider the opinions of independent directors and public investors in the profit distribution policy decision-making process[35]. - The company will provide online voting options for shareholders during the profit distribution proposal review[41]. - The company aims to ensure continuous and stable returns to investors through an active profit distribution policy[35]. - The company will adjust its profit distribution policy in response to significant adverse impacts from external factors or changes in its operational environment[41]. - The company plans to conduct annual dividends and may propose interim dividends based on funding needs[38]. - The company implemented a 2021 annual profit distribution plan on June 7, 2022, distributing a cash dividend of 7.50 RMB per 10 shares and increasing capital stock by 6 shares for every 10 shares held, resulting in a total increase of 63,763,737 shares[114]. - The company approved a profit distribution plan, distributing a cash dividend of 4.70 RMB per 10 shares (including tax) to all shareholders, based on a total of 170,672,194 shares[185]. - The company will not issue any bonus shares but will increase capital reserves by converting 6 shares for every 10 shares held by shareholders[185]. Industry and Market Position - The company focuses on precision laser processing solutions, primarily for the photovoltaic industry, providing customized and comprehensive laser processing equipment and services[52]. - The company is actively developing laser processing equipment for high-end consumer electronics, new displays, and integrated circuits[52]. - The company is focusing on the industrialization of advanced solar cell technologies such as TOPCON, HJT, and IBC, as well as perovskite and tandem cell components[106]. - N-type battery technologies are becoming the main production force, with significant improvements in conversion efficiency and lower light-induced degradation[106]. - The company has made breakthroughs in laser technology for various solar cell processes, enhancing conversion efficiency and reducing costs[106]. - The smart manufacturing equipment industry is a key development direction, with the company’s products significantly improving production efficiency and precision[107]. - The photovoltaic industry is rapidly growing, with China leading globally in manufacturing scale and technology levels, contributing to the country's carbon neutrality goals[107]. - The company is actively researching and applying new efficient and low-cost photovoltaic technologies, including intelligent photovoltaic pilot demonstrations[106]. - The company’s laser technology is positioned to support the transition to smart manufacturing, with broad applications across various industries[106]. - The global demand for photovoltaic installations is expected to continue growing, driven by renewable energy strategies and policy support[107]. - The company aims to provide high-value laser solutions across different battery processes, ensuring adaptability to future market trends[106]. - The company achieved a significant growth in the photovoltaic industry, with the production of polysilicon, silicon wafers, battery cells, and modules reaching 827,000 tons, 357 GW, 318 GW, and 288.7 GW respectively, representing year-on-year growth rates of 63.4%, 57.5%, 60.7%, and 58.8%[169]. - The company is positioned as a leader in the micro-nano laser precision processing field, having successfully applied laser technology to various high-efficiency solar cell technologies, including PERC, TOPCON, IBC, HJT, and perovskite[169]. - The global market share for the company's PERC laser ablation and SE laser doping equipment is significantly ahead of competitors, with successful mass production orders in TOPCON and back-contact battery technologies[169]. - The company anticipates that domestic photovoltaic new installations in 2023 will reach between 95 GW and 120 GW, while global new installations are expected to be between 280 GW and 330 GW[169]. - The company has received mass production orders for laser micro-etching equipment used in back-contact batteries, showcasing its technological leadership in the industry[169]. - The company is committed to continuous innovation and expansion into semiconductor, panel display, and consumer electronics sectors to improve profitability and reduce operational risks[169].
